Backend Developer H-1B Salaries
227 certified H-1B filings · FY2016–FY2026 · median base $105k.
Median base
$105k
Middle 50%
$85k–$123k
Filings
227
Top sponsor
IBM
Pay distribution
Base salary distribution
Whiskers reach P10–P90; the box is the P25–P75 interquartile range; the heavy line is the median. Base salary only.
By fiscal year
| Fiscal year | Filings | Median base |
|---|---|---|
| FY2026 | 4 | $113k |
| FY2025 | 43 | $109k |
| FY2024 | 40 | $107k |
| FY2023 | 20 | $110k |
| FY2022 | 44 | $99k |
| FY2021 | 11 | $93k |
| FY2020 | 7 | $110k |
| FY2019 | 22 | $90k |
| FY2018 | 17 | $91k |
| FY2017 | 12 | $80k |
| FY2016 | 7 | $121k |

Frequently asked questions
- What is the median H-1B salary for a Backend Developer?
- The median certified H-1B base salary for Backend Developer is $105k (FY2026), from 227 filings. The middle 50% earn between $85k and $123k.
- Which companies sponsor the most H-1B Backend Developers?
- The top H-1B sponsors for Backend Developer are IBM, Autorentals Com, Photon Infotech.
- Where are most H-1B Backend Developer jobs located?
- The top worksite locations for H-1B Backend Developer roles are Austin, TX, San Francisco, CA, New York, NY.
